The Art of Programming · Algorithms & Programming

Data Structures

Working with variables, constants, and arrays to manage and manipulate information.

Key Questions

  1. 1Why is it important to choose the correct data type before processing information?
  2. 2How do arrays allow us to handle large volumes of data more efficiently than individual variables?
  3. 3What are the risks of using global variables compared to local variables within a program?

National Curriculum Attainment Targets

GCSE: Computing - Programming FundamentalsGCSE: Computing - Data Structures
Year: Year 10
Subject: Computing
Unit: The Art of Programming
Period: Algorithms & Programming

Ready to teach this topic?

Generate a complete, classroom-ready active learning mission in seconds.

Browse curriculum by country

AmericasUSCAMXCLCOBR
Asia & PacificINSGAU